Programming as a Service (SaaS) is a generally new methodology supplanting conventional programming permit buy.
For what reason is it more well known among the two clients and specialist co-ops? How is such programming made? How about we plunge into SaaS application advancement together!
A Quick Step By Step Guide On The SaaS Application
Instructions to Build a Cloud-Based SaaS Application in 5 steps how to Build a Cloud-Based SaaS Application in 5 Steps
What Is a SaaS Application?
Programming as a Service (SaaS) is a generally new deals model that is supplanting customary programming licenses.
For what reason is SaaS programming well known among the two clients and programming organizations?
How is SaaS programming made? How about we jump into SaaS application improvement together!
Do you recall when purchasing programming implied hurrying to the nearby hardware store or requesting an actual CD on the web? Innovation has changed radically over the most recent 10 years.
Today, the product business is overwhelmed by the Software as a Service conveyance and evaluating model.
SaaS is a famous (and sometimes disputable) theme in the tech media today.
That is the reason we’ve composed this article to reveal insight into SaaS web applications and stages.
In case you’re thinking about how to fabricate a SaaS item or regardless of whether a SaaS engineering is a decent choice for your task, read on.
What Is a SaaS Application?
A SaaS application is programming authorized utilizing the Software as a Service plan of action.
SaaS is a way to deal with programming conveyance and upkeep wherein designers don’t sell their projects with a lifetime permit or delay until the following year’s adaptation to deliver include refreshes.
All things considered, organizations market their product as a help (consequently the name), ordinarily by means of a membership model.
These administrations are facilitated in the cloud, which implies they don’t should be truly introduced on your PC.
The utilization of distributed computing gives SaaS arrangements a small bunch of advantages:
- Cost effectiveness
There’s no compelling reason to purchase and keep up with costly equipment, and you just compensation for the assets your application employments.
In the event that your necessities increment, you can update your arrangement in a couple of snaps. Minimizations are likewise conceivable.
A cloud is an organization of workers that can be situated all throughout the planet. Regardless of whether one worker goes down, your application will stay on the web.
Cloud specialist organizations give close consideration to security to guarantee your information is put away in a protected spot.
Cloud-based Web applications are open from any gadget anyplace on the planet.
Additionally, clients consistently approach the most recent variant of cloud-based programming, as there’s no compelling reason to download refreshes.
Being Cloud-Based, SaaS applications enjoy numerous upper hands over on-premises applications.
Examination of Saas Programming Versus Customary Programming
The distinction among SaaS and on-premises programming is best represented with a model.
How about we consider a well-known item that, as of late, made the progress from the conventional programming conveyance model to the SaaS model — Adobe Photoshop.
In the event that you utilize or work with visual makers, you’ve most likely seen Photoshop in real life.
A long time back, Adobe Photoshop, alongside endless different projects, were offered to customers at a one-time cost.
When the purchaser paid, they were given a key to get to a specific variant of Photoshop endlessly.
However, there has been pushback against the membership pattern. The SaaS model has gotten on in light of the fact that it offers benefits for the two engineers and clients.
- Benefits of Saas
There are a couple of center benefits of a SaaS design for the two clients and engineers:
Normal and longer-enduring income for designers
Lower front and center expenses for clients
Engineers can draw in a bigger potential client base (because of lower front and center expenses)
Clients get standard, moment refreshes, and new provisions without buying new forms.
A Time For Testing Allows Clients To See Whether The Help Meets Their Requirements
Through a site, clients can get consistent and moment admittance to a SaaS application with every one of the most recent overhauls and components.
Furthermore, they keep away from high beginning up costs, regardless of whether those are immediate installments to engineers or equipment updates expected to run the product locally.
A critical distinction in making cloud applications is the need to choose a cloud administrations supplier.
One of the focal provisions and advantages of cloud arrangements is that supporters regularly don’t need to download or introduce programming on their end gadgets.
This is extraordinary information for clients, who don’t need to follow through on a high straightforward cost for the actual application and don’t need to forfeit significant extra room and figuring ability to run the application and take care of business.
Requirement For Extra Room And Computational Force Doesn’t Simply Vanish
Rather than running on end gadgets, Software as Service arrangements commonly do their processing in the background in the cloud.
Solid Cloud Administration That Can Have Your SaaS Stage And Empower Advantageous
To assemble a solid cloud application, you ought to choose a dependable cloud have.
In a perfect world, you’ll need to choose one with low benchmark costs yet, in addition, the capacity to scale as your foundation and client base extends.
Amazon Web Services (AWS) is one well-known cloud administrations supplier with an assortment of devices for SaaS engineers.
In any case, we suggest you do your own examination in the wake of characterizing the particular requirements of your foundation.
Hints for SaaS advancement
The following are five additional tips for building cloud-based applications.
- Offer your clients a reasonable and solid assistance
The SaaS model expects you to offer strong and predictable help. Clients will pursue a membership.
However, they will not do as such for everything. How might you tell if the advantage you give is the right fit to the SaaS plan of action?
We should take a gander at a true illustration of when and where SaaS doesn’t function admirably.
Once, I was looking for an approach to change over between two explicit record types.
Neither one of the records type was exclusive, so I figured I would have the option to track down a straightforward internet-based converter that would take care of business free of charge.
However, I immediately tracked down that numerous converters had moved to a SaaS-based model that necessary me to pursue a month-to-month membership to change over my record.
This was disappointing. Why? Since I simply expected to change over a solitary document, and I just utilize this record type about once at regular intervals.
It was absolutely impossible that I planned to pursue regularly scheduled installments for this sort of programming.
However I most likely would have been willing to pay a couple of dollars to utilize it only a single time.
- Do statistical surveying and characterize your rivals
Numerous designers and application proprietors get so cleared up in the SaaS publicity that they neglect to approve their venture thought by checking out probably the best wellspring of true proof: the opposition.
Have your rivals taken on a SaaS model? If not, that doesn’t mean it’s anything but a decent choice.
You simply need to ensure your client base will pursue a membership as opposed to putting resources into your item forthright.
In the event that your web application is in a circle that overwhelmingly follows a conventional conveyance model, its advantages should surpass those presented by your compe